New President In Ghana...

 

John Atta Mills, (left) of the opposition NDC has defeated Nana Akufo-Addo,(right) of the ruling NPP in the runoff election in Ghana, West Africa. The two men led a field of eight candidates in the December 7, 2008 general election, but neither secured a majority of the votes. Akufo-Addo had held a slight lead in that voting. The chairman of the Ghana Electoral Commission, Kwadwo Afari-Gyan, said Mills had garnered about 4,521,032 votes, or about 50.2 percent of the total votes cast.
